Nursery schools

Young girl being shown a hedgehog

We offer a range of services for nursery school pupils, including:

  • full education visits
  • self-guided education visits
  • outreach service.

All our options are based around the theme of Let's Look at Animals.

This topic aims to get children thinking about a range of ideas, rather than one particular theme.

During full education and outreach visits, pupils are encouraged to study an animal's colours and patterns, texture, movements, food habits and key features.

Our animals

Belfast Zoo is home to more than 1,200 animals and 140 different species.

The majority of our animals are in danger in their natural habitat.

About the zoo

Belfast Zoo opened in 1934 and is one of Northern Ireland's top attractions.

It receives more than 300,000 visitors a year.
